South Korea has walked back its proposed tax on artificial intelligence investments, a move that briefly rattled Micron Technology (MU) shares before the selloff quickly faded. Analysts view the episode as a non-event, underscoring the market’s focus on long-term demand for memory chips tied to AI expansion.

In recent days, South Korea’s government reversed its earlier proposal to impose a tax on AI-related investments, a policy shift that had initially triggered a short-lived dip in shares of Micron Technology (NASDAQ: MU). The original proposal had raised concerns among semiconductor firms operating in the region, as it could have increased costs for building AI infrastructure. However, after consultations with industry stakeholders, officials walked back the plan, according to media reports. The brief selloff in MU stock was contained and the shares recovered shortly after the announcement, with market participants largely dismissing the move as overblown. Trading volumes during the episode were described as within normal ranges, suggesting no panic selling. The development highlights the sensitivity of the semiconductor sector to regulatory noise, but also reinforces the market’s confidence in the ongoing AI-driven demand cycle for memory products. Key Highlights
- South Korea’s original AI tax proposal would have levied additional charges on investments in AI data centers and chip manufacturing, potentially affecting companies like Micron with significant operations in the country.
- The swift reversal indicates the government’s commitment to maintaining a competitive environment for the semiconductor industry, a critical pillar of South Korea’s economy.
- The brief selloff in MU shares was limited in duration and magnitude, leading most analysts to view it as a non-event that did not alter the company’s fundamental trajectory.
- Supports from the broader fundamentals for Micron remain intact, including robust demand for high-bandwidth memory (HBM) used in AI training and inference workloads.
- The policy noise is unlikely to materially impact Micron’s global supply chain or pricing power, as the company’s manufacturing footprint is diversified beyond South Korea.
- The episode underscores how regulatory headlines can create short-term volatility, but the underlying technology cycle—driven by AI adoption and memory content growth—remains the primary driver for memory stocks.

Expert Insights
Market observers note that while regulatory proposals can cause temporary jitters, the fundamental outlook for Micron remains anchored by the accelerating deployment of AI infrastructure. The South Korean tax reversal removes a potential overhang, but investors should continue to monitor broader geopolitical and trade dynamics that could affect the semiconductor supply chain. Analyst commentary has cautioned against reading too much into short-lived price movements, emphasizing that Micron’s valuation is more tied to product cycles, inventory trends, and end-market demand. Looking ahead, the company’s ability to capitalize on AI demand through its HBM3E and next-generation memory products would likely be the key catalyst.
